Leadership Review Briefing — Western Corridor Sales

Quick read for the board: Dornell Foods' western corridor had a solid half — revenue up 9%, with the Pickford range doing most of the heavy lifting. Averlane stores lagged, mostly down to late fixture upgrades. Full numbers are in the appendix. For context, the confidential note below outlines where we're steering things next.

management briefing: The board signed off on a budget of $30.3 million for Project Fraion. The renewal with Belvanox Freight closes at $15.8 million a year, 45 percent above the last contract.

Welcome to the Marlowe Building. The loading dock on Ferris Lane accepts deliveries weekdays from 07:30 to 15:00 only; arrivals outside these hours will be turned away by the dock steward. Please reverse in slowly and keep engines off while unloading. To open the contractor gate, use the code below.

turnstile pass: bdg-YPPQB-52010

# Vexley Licensing Dispute — Managers Only

Quick update for branch managers, since customers keep asking. Torvald Systems has challenged our license to distribute the Vexley plugin suite, claiming our reseller terms lapsed in the spring. Our counsel disagrees, and we're continuing to sell while talks proceed — so no change at the counter for now. If a customer raises it, route them to the escalation desk rather than improvising. Mediation is scheduled for next month in Calderon. There's one piece of context you should hold closely.

management briefing: The renewal with Zoraelax Group closes at $10 million a year, 15 percent below the last contract. Project Ralael slips by six weeks because of the audit delay.

# --------------------------------------------------------------
# Transcode farm scheduler constants (Pipewright cluster)
#
# These values govern how many concurrent encode jobs each worker
# node accepts, how long a stalled segment waits before requeue,
# and the GOP chunk size handed to each encoder. They were tuned
# against the autumn load tests; changing them without rerunning
# the soak suite tends to cause segment pileups on the 4K lane.
# Do not adjust casually. The current production values are
# defined immediately below.

tuning table, yajeg-bahif:
RATE_LIMITS = {
    "oliath": 1,
    "holael": 10,
}